The arrangement in 1944 recognized central financial management guidelines between Australia, Japan, the United States, Canada, and a variety of Western European nations. Generally, the world's economy remained in shambles after World War II, so 730 delegates from 44 Allied countries gathered in New Hampshire in a hotel called Bretton Woods. International Currency.

Treasury department authorities Harry Dexter White. Many historians believe the closed-door Bretton Woods conference centralized the whole world's financial system (fox news ratings compared to other networks). On the meeting's final day, Bretton Woods delegates codified a code of guidelines for the world's financial system and conjured up the World Bank Group and the IMF. Basically, because the U.S. controlled more than two-thirds of the world's gold, the system would rely on gold and the U.S. dollar. Nevertheless, Richard Nixon surprised the world when he removed the gold part out of the Bretton Woods pact in August 1971. The editorialist was Henry Hazlitt and his posts like "End the IMF" were very controversial to the status quo. In the editorial, Hazlitt stated that he composed extensively about how the introduction of the IMF had triggered huge nationwide currency devaluations. Hazlitt described the British pound lost a 3rd of its worth overnight in 1949. "In the years from the end of 1952 to the end of 1962, 43 leading currencies depreciated," the financial expert detailed back in 1963. "The U.S. dollar revealed a loss in internal acquiring power of 12 percent, the British pound of 25 percent, the French franc of 30 percent.
